MySQL安装:四步轻松搞定圆圈教程

资源类型:wx-1.com 2025-07-29 14:36

mysql安装四个圈圈简介:



MySQL安装:四步详解,轻松构建数据库基石 在当今数据驱动的时代,MySQL作为开源数据库管理系统中的佼佼者,凭借其稳定性、高性能和广泛的社区支持,成为了众多企业和开发者的首选

    无论是构建复杂的企业级应用,还是快速原型开发,MySQL都能提供强大的数据支撑

    然而,对于初学者或是初次尝试安装MySQL的用户来说,安装过程可能会显得有些复杂

    本文将通过“四个圈圈”这一简洁明了的方式,详细介绍MySQL的安装步骤,让您轻松上手,快速构建起数据库基石

     圈圈一:环境准备——奠定基石 第一步:了解系统需求 在开始安装MySQL之前,首要任务是确认您的操作系统环境是否满足MySQL的最低硬件和软件要求

    MySQL支持多种操作系统,包括Windows、Linux(如Ubuntu、CentOS)、macOS等

    访问MySQL官方网站,查阅最新的系统要求文档,确保您的系统配置达标

     第二步:安装必要工具 根据您的操作系统,可能需要预先安装一些必要的工具和依赖包

    例如,在Linux系统上,您可能需要安装`wget`、`gcc`、`make`等开发工具包,以及`libaio`库(对于某些Linux发行版)

    这些工具和库文件有助于MySQL的安装和性能优化

     第三步:设置用户权限 出于安全考虑,建议为MySQL创建一个专门的系统用户,并赋予其必要的权限

    在Linux系统中,您可以使用`useradd`命令创建用户,并通过`chown`和`chmod`命令调整文件和目录的所有权及权限

     圈圈二:下载MySQL安装包——获取源码 第四步:访问MySQL官网 访问MySQL官方网站(https://dev.mysql.com/downloads/),这是获取最新稳定版MySQL安装包的官方渠道

    页面上提供了针对不同操作系统、不同安装需求(如二进制包、源码包、RPM包等)的下载选项

     第五步:选择合适的安装包 根据您的操作系统类型和安装偏好,选择合适的安装包

    对于大多数用户来说,二进制安装包是最方便的选择,因为它已经编译好,只需解压并配置即可使用

    而对于需要定制化编译的用户,源码包则提供了更大的灵活性

     第六步:下载并验证安装包 点击下载链接后,根据提示保存安装包到本地

    下载完成后,建议校验安装包的MD5或SHA256哈希值,以确保文件在传输过程中未被篡改

    MySQL官网提供了每个安装包的校验和值,您可以使用`md5sum`或`sha256sum`命令进行验证

     圈圈三:安装MySQL——构建核心 第七步:解压安装包 对于二进制安装包,将其解压到您希望安装的目录

    在Linux上,可以使用`tar`命令完成解压

    例如:`tar -zxvf mysql-x.x.xx-linux-glibc2.12-x86_64.tar.gz -C /usr/local/`

     第八步:初始化数据库 在MySQL5.7及更高版本中,初始化数据库是一个重要步骤

    使用`mysqld --initialize`命令(或`mysqld --initialize-insecure`以不设置root密码的方式初始化),这将创建系统表和其他必要的数据库结构

     第九步:配置MySQL服务 根据您的系统类型,创建MySQL服务脚本,并将其添加到系统服务管理器中

    在Linux上,可以复制MySQL提供的示例配置文件到`/etc/my.cnf`,并根据需要调整配置参数

    之后,使用`systemctl enable mysqld`命令将MySQL服务设置为开机自启动

     第十步:启动MySQL服务 使用`systemctl start mysqld`命令启动MySQL服务

    启动成功后,可以通过`systemctl status mysqld`检查服务状态,确保MySQL正在运行

     圈圈四:安全配置与测试——加固防线 第十一步:运行安全脚本 MySQL提供了一个名为`mysql_secure_installation`的安全配置脚本,它可以帮助您完成一系列安全增强措施,包括设置root密码、删除匿名用户、禁止远程root登录、删除测试数据库等

    运行此脚本是保障数据库安全的关键步骤

     第十二步:创建数据库和用户 登录MySQL命令行客户端(使用`mysql -u root -p`命令),根据您的应用需求创建数据库和用户,并为用户分配相应的权限

    良好的权限管理能有效防止未授权访问和数据泄露

     第十三步:测试连接 使用MySQL客户端工具或编程语言(如PHP、Python)编写的脚本,尝试连接到新安装的MySQL数据库,执行一些基本的SQL查询,以验证安装和配置是否成功

     第十四步:持续监控与优化 安装完成后,不要忽视对MySQL性能的持续监控和优化

    利用MySQL自带的性能模式(Performance Schema)、慢查询日志等工具,分析数据库运行状况,适时调整配置参数,优化查询语句,确保数据库高效稳定运行

     结语 通过上述“四个圈圈”——环境准备、下载安装包、安装MySQL、安全配置与测试,我们系统地介绍了MySQL的安装过程

    每一步都力求详尽,旨在帮助初学者克服安装障碍,顺利构建数据库基石

    记住,安装只是开始,MySQL的强大功能在于其灵活的配置和广泛的应用场景

    随着您对MySQL了解的深入,不妨探索更多高级功能,如复制、分区、全文检索等,以充分发挥MySQL的潜力,为您的应用提供坚实的数据支持

    

阅读全文
上一篇:MySQL索引失效之谜:如何避免查询性能陷阱?这个标题既包含了“MySQL索引”这一关键词,又突出了索引可能失效的问题,同时提出了如何避免的性能陷阱,能够吸引对数据库性能优化感兴趣的读者。

最新收录:

  • 从终端轻松进入MySQL数据库:详细步骤指南
  • MySQL索引失效之谜:如何避免查询性能陷阱?这个标题既包含了“MySQL索引”这一关键词,又突出了索引可能失效的问题,同时提出了如何避免的性能陷阱,能够吸引对数据库性能优化感兴趣的读者。
  • MySQL高手必修课:如何灵活导入不同表名的数据?
  • MySQL安装后一片空白?解决方案来了!
  • MySQL高级面试:揭秘数据库专家必备技能
  • MySQL技巧:如何高效判断数据是否相同
  • MySQL中datetime字段为空处理技巧
  • MySQL表关联技巧:轻松构建数据间联系
  • MySQL多参数模糊匹配技巧大揭秘
  • MySQL Poldb数据库应用指南
  • MySQL安装教程:如何正确输入当前密码步骤详解
  • MySQL力扣刷题指南:高效提升,顺序攻略
  • 首页 | mysql安装四个圈圈:MySQL安装:四步轻松搞定圆圈教程